October 2025 – GEW becomes Main Sponsor of Haywards Heath RFC

GEW is proud to announce the elevation of its ongoing sponsorship of Haywards Heath Rugby Football Club (HHRFC), having recently become the official Main Sponsor of the West Sussex club. The sponsorship is for a minimum three year term and will run until at least June 2028.

GEW has been a strong supporter of HHRFC for the past three years, sponsoring the goal post protectors and corner flags. This new, extended partnership with the club will help raise the company’s profile via a true grassroots sports club. GEW will feature on the front of match shirts for the 1st XV, RAMs, Vets and new Women’s squads, plus Colts and gradually introduced for all youth age groups to ensure the sustainable transfer of shirts.

With over 500 HHRFC youth players, all existing shirts handed in during this season will go to young players in Uganda and other African nations via the Tag Rugby Trust – a charity that the Club has supported for a while. In return HHRFC youth players will receive a new match shirt for just £10.

Phil Herbert, HHRFC Commercial Director commented, “We look forward to working closely with GEW to promote the shared values of inclusivity, accessibility and sport for all. The new Clubhouse at Whitemans Green has been designed to be welcoming to everyone regardless of age and gender and the addition of three canopied padel courts has extended its appeal. GEW recognises and supports this commitment as the Club continues to work to raise funds to build a community gym that will further benefit the wider community, not just rugby players.”

Malcolm and Gillian Rae, co-owners of GEW added, “HHRFC offers a natural partnership opportunity for our business, making sure that as many people as possible have access to sport and social facilities. We are excited to help the Club achieve its ambitions on and off the pitch over the next three years.”
